5-Year Running Costs

FuelUS$8,659
InsuranceUS$5,835 (modelled)
MaintenanceUS$5,200 (class estimate)
RepairsUS$8,000 (modelled)
Depreciationnot estimated — we hold no purchase price for this car, and it is not assumed.
Totalnot estimated — a component above is unknown or modelled

Running costs only — the purchase price is not included. The five-year running cost is an ESTIMATE, not a measurement of this car: only its fuel half is computed from the car's own measured consumption and a dated pump price (see fuel_price_source and fuel_price_as_of in the market's own figures); insurance, maintenance and repairs are class models. It orders no list and is not one of this market's published figures. Fuel is this car's own combined consumption over 15,000 km a year at 1.738 CAD a litre of petrol (Statistics Canada. Table 18-10-0001-01 Monthly average retail prices for gasoline and fuel oil, by geography; Canada; regular unleaded gasoline at self service filling stations, 2026-08). Adapted from Statistics Canada, Table 18-10-0001-01 Monthly average retail prices for gasoline and fuel oil, by geography, August 2026. This does not constitute an endorsement by Statistics Canada of this product. Costs are in US dollars; the CAD pump price is converted at 1 CAD = 0.73 USD, the rate set on 2026-09-13. Insurance, maintenance and repairs are models, not figures for this car: insurance from its power, weight and crash rating, maintenance from its make's class, repairs from its complaint and recall counts. They are shown for scale and are not used to rank it. Confidence is low: several components are modelled from class averages.

Known Issues

ENGINE
71 complaint(s) · 1 reports a crash, fire, injury or death
